diff options
author | Mamut Ghiunhan <V3n3RiX@users.noreply.github.com> | 2015-06-13 06:13:41 +0100 |
---|---|---|
committer | Mamut Ghiunhan <V3n3RiX@users.noreply.github.com> | 2015-06-13 06:13:41 +0100 |
commit | d9035f30584b027bfddb2d96ff6fd9052f79c7c1 (patch) | |
tree | e97c7068fb860d29f978dc31e15a44bb7f3b1d3d /sys-auth/polkit-qt4/polkit-qt4-0.112.0-r1.ebuild | |
parent | 6ad895abb1a6d4d221c5289f09483eecdf2b67a3 (diff) | |
parent | 301fe36963716f5f2dc57cca456649ce1baa416b (diff) |
Merge pull request #45 from V3n3RiX/master
split polkit-qt in polkit-q4 && polkit-qt5
Diffstat (limited to 'sys-auth/polkit-qt4/polkit-qt4-0.112.0-r1.ebuild')
-rw-r--r-- | sys-auth/polkit-qt4/polkit-qt4-0.112.0-r1.ebuild | 68 |
1 files changed, 68 insertions, 0 deletions
diff --git a/sys-auth/polkit-qt4/polkit-qt4-0.112.0-r1.ebuild b/sys-auth/polkit-qt4/polkit-qt4-0.112.0-r1.ebuild new file mode 100644 index 00000000..9c39b03d --- /dev/null +++ b/sys-auth/polkit-qt4/polkit-qt4-0.112.0-r1.ebuild @@ -0,0 +1,68 @@ +# Copyright 1999-2015 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 +# $Header: /var/cvsroot/gentoo-x86/sys-auth/polkit-qt/polkit-qt-0.112.0-r1.ebuild,v 1.6 2015/05/16 10:14:07 jer Exp $ + +EAPI=5 + +MY_P="${P/qt4/qt-1}" + +inherit cmake-utils multibuild + +DESCRIPTION="PolicyKit Qt4 API wrapper library" +HOMEPAGE="http://www.kde.org/" +SRC_URI="mirror://kde/stable/apps/KDE4.x/admin/${MY_P}.tar.bz2" + +LICENSE="LGPL-2" +SLOT="0" +KEYWORDS="amd64 ~arm ~arm64 ppc ppc64 x86 ~x86-fbsd" +IUSE="+qt4" + +REQUIRED_USE="|| ( qt4 )" + +RDEPEND=" + dev-libs/glib:2 + >=sys-auth/polkit-0.103 + qt4? ( + dev-qt/qtcore:4[glib] + dev-qt/qtdbus:4 + dev-qt/qtgui:4[glib] + ) +" +DEPEND="${RDEPEND}" + +DOCS=( AUTHORS README README.porting TODO ) + +S=${WORKDIR}/${MY_P} + +# bug #529686 +RESTRICT="test" + +pkg_setup() { + MULTIBUILD_VARIANTS=() + use qt4 && MULTIBUILD_VARIANTS+=( qt4 ) +} + +src_configure() { + myconfigure() { + local mycmakeargs=( + -DSYSCONF_INSTALL_DIR="${EPREFIX}"/etc + $(cmake-utils_use_build examples) + ) + + if [[ ${MULTIBUILD_VARIANT} = qt4 ]] ; then + mycmakeargs+=( -DUSE_QT4=ON ) + fi + + cmake-utils_src_configure + } + + multibuild_foreach_variant myconfigure +} + +src_compile() { + multibuild_foreach_variant cmake-utils_src_compile +} + +src_install() { + multibuild_foreach_variant cmake-utils_src_install +} |